Double Stroller With Car Seat Compatability
Parents with twins or other multiples may require a double stroller that can hold two infant car seats at once. The TwinRoo+ is an easy-to-use frame stroller that can fit 23 different car seat models.
It also has a large storage basket, parent cup holders and reversible seating with best-in-class legroom between the two seats.
The Baby Trend(r) Universal Double Snap-N-Go (r)
The Baby Trend(r) Universal Double Snap-N-Go(r) is a fantastic stroller that will fit most infant car seats. It has large storage baskets and a parent tray with two cup holders. The stroller is light and folds up easily for storage or transport. It is one of our easiest strollers to maneuver and is a great side-by-side design. It's not very effective in our jog test, and isn't as adept on steeper curbs. The front wheels that swivel have trouble with catching on obstacles.
The adapters for this stroller are simple to put in and work with all major brands. However, the stroller can only accommodate one infant car seat carrier at a time. Parents of twins will have to look for another option if they want to use their infant car seats together. The UPPAbaby Vista V2 Double and the Evenflo Pivot Xpand Double are top scoring options that work with two infant car seats simultaneously.
While the Baby Trend is easy to use and comes with a nice basket, it falls short of our ride comfort metric. The stroller doesn't have shocks to withstand the bumps and vibrations of the road, which can be hard on little passengers. Also, the lack of a reclined seat means children will feel every bump on the road. This isn't an issue as the passengers get older, but it's something to consider if your children are young toddlers or infants.

The Contours(r), Options Elite V2 double stroller
The Contours(r), Options Elite V2 includes the features parents are raving about: reversible seating, one-hand recline as well as adjustable leg rests and zippered extensions on both canopies. It also has a cup holder for parents. In addition, it comes with amazing new features, like the height-adjustable handle, as well as quilted seats. It has seven different configurations of seating, including the difficult to find double-rear-facing position. This allows children to look at each other while keeping an eye on their parents.
The stroller's compatibility to multiple infant car seats is one of its greatest features. It provides families with more choices and prevents them from being tied to a single brand of stroller that is compatible with the baby car seat. The Options Elite works with Graco and Britax infant car seats with an adapter that is universal that can also be used with the UPPAbaby Mesa and Baby Jogger City Select double car seats. It has an additional adapter for when you have twins or need to use two infant car seat.
It's not a side-byside stroller It has the look of a single stroller and is able to be used in all aisles and doorways with ease. While it's not as movable like a jogging-style stroller it's still a great option for shopping or road trip excursions. It weighs slightly more than other double strollers, however it's not too heavy for petite women to carry and maneuver.
The seats are comfortable for children and there's a decent storage basket. The canopy is also big and can be opened to give more sun protection. However, it doesn't have a large storage space for parent necessities and some families may find to be inconvenient.
This stroller comes with an electronic foot brake and safety harness. It also comes with five-point harnesses for every child. The front wheels can be locked to provide stability and the handles are ergonomically designed. It's easy to fold and stands up when folded. It doesn't fold with one hand as other strollers on this list however, it's easy to fold after a few hours of practice.
The Evenflo Pivot Xpand Double
The Evenflo Pivot Xpand Double is a great budget-friendly favorite that will grow with your family. It offers car seat compatibility and reversible seating within an elegant, modern stroller frame. It is simple to use and features an easy fold that permits self-standing. It's a good value, considering its lower price. It does have an unmistakably heavier feel than the majority of competitors and smaller wheels that have difficulty with pushing off-road or in tight corners and narrow doorways.
This stroller can be used with two infant car seats or toddler seats (sold separately) and no adapters are required. Adding a second seat expands the frame of the stroller in just a few minutes without tools or other parts, and can be used in 23 configurations in the USA to accommodate toddler and infant seats at different heights in both parent-facing or forward-facing settings. The second seat can be used in stroller mode to accommodate larger children or to cradle the infant at an angle that is comfortable for infant mode.
A large, oversized storage basket, as well as back and front-accessible seat pockets add to this stroller's utility, while the cushioned, contoured seat provides maximum comfort for passengers. An extendable canopy protects children from the sun's rays, while the peek-aboo window lets parents to watch their little ones.
The addition of the Stroller Rider Board creates a tandem for siblings to ride in tandem, or be used in lieu of the standard toddler seat. The flex-hold cupholder can hold a variety of drinks, and the stroller is easily foldable with the toddler seat connected, making it simple to access storage space.
Most reviewers are pleased with the ease with which the Pivot Xpand stroller can be expanded to include a second seat. Some have mentioned that it is difficult to attach an infant car seat onto the included mounts, while attaching the second toddler seat is easier and faster. Evenflo offers a video chat feature for customers to ask any questions or get assistance with attaching car seats. The only other major drawback for this stroller is its short warranty.
The Jeep Bravo For 2
The Bravo For 2 is an excellent stroller for siblings of similar ages. It is easy to assemble right out of the box. And unlike other sit-and-stand strollers, it is relatively lightweight at just 23 pounds. The seats can recline in multiple positions to allow your baby or toddler to snooze and there is even a footrest for those who need it. The padded handlebar can be positioned so that older children can grasp it even if they're wearing gloves. Many parents have said that this feature alone makes it more secure than the majority of its rivals.
This stroller comes with a cushioned back seat that can fit the child up to two years old. This lets you keep your child rear-facing for longer, which is a big benefit for parents who are a part of the #TurnAfter2 movement that encourages babies and toddlers to be rear-facing until they reach the age of two years old. This seat is easy to buckle and has the same five-point harness that is used in the front seat.
The Bravo For 2 has another advantage: it can accept the Chicco KeyFit car seat or Fit2 in the front. Simply push down on the front seat, slide in your infant carrier, and listen for the sound which indicates that it is secure. This makes it one of the most versatile double strollers available. It also allows you to avoid buying a stroller that is only used a few times and will end in your garage, or donated to a second-hand store.
The only drawback to this stroller is that it does not come with a parent tray or cup holders, and the storage space is somewhat restricted. However, it is still an excellent choice for families with just one child who will be walking for the duration of their stroll, and younger siblings in a car seat in front. It is also an excellent option for traveling as it folds easily into smaller dimensions that can be gate-checked a plane or stow away in your trunk.
